About This Role
We are building a dedicated care team to support a friendly and engaging gentleman as he prepares to transition from a rehabilitation setting back to his own home in Walkden.
He has a great love of music, particularly blues, jazz, and rock, and is a keen Manchester City supporter. He enjoys watching the news, has a strong interest in politics and current affairs, and values meaningful conversation.
He is very much looking forward to resuming an active life within his community with the support of his dedicated care team, including visiting some of his favourite local places.
We are recruiting for a live-in Healthcare Assistant for a rota of one week live-in, one week off. You will work closely alongside a Registered Nurse to ensure the safe management of his clinical care needs.
Your role will include supporting with personal care, safe moving and handling, and assisting with clinical interventions. You will also support both daily and night routines while encouraging and enabling him to take part in activities that are meaningful and enjoyable to him.
Candidates will need to attend training and shadowing at Southport Spinal Injury Unit to support the transition home.
This is a rewarding opportunity to make a genuine difference by supporting someone to live comfortably and safely in their own home.
